Colleges Accepting CLAT Scores Other Than NLU
Colleges Accepting CLAT Scores Other Than NLU: Many reputed law colleges in India accept CLAT scores for admission apart from the National Law Universities (NLUs). These include a wide range of private institutions such as UPES University Dehradun and BITS Law School Mumbai, which offer admission to UG and PG law courses based on CLAT scores. With over 60 colleges outside the NLU system considering CLAT scores, aspirants have several quality alternatives to pursue legal education even if they do not secure a seat in an NLU. These colleges provide diverse opportunities and can be a strong foundation for a successful legal career.

Colleges Accepting CLAT Scorecard Other Than NLU

The Common Law Admission Test (CLAT) scorecard is mainly used for admission to National Law Universities (NLUs) in India. However, several private and affiliated colleges accept the CLAT scorecard for admission to UG and PG law courses. These institutions offer quality legal education and are excellent alternatives for aspiring law students. Here's a list of notable non-NLU colleges accepting CLAT scores.

1. Siksha ‘O’ Anusadhan University, Bhubaneswar

Siksha ‘O’ Anusandhan University (SOA), Bhubaneswar, is a UGC-approved and NAAC-accredited deemed university offering a range of undergraduate, postgraduate, and doctoral programs, including law. For its law courses, SOA accepts CLAT scores as one of the qualifying criteria for admission, alongside its entrance exam, SAAT. Candidates can apply for law programs at SOA using their CLAT scores, and admissions are finalized through a merit-based counseling process. 2. Indore Institute of Law

Indore Institute of Law (IIL), established in 2003, is a private law college in Madhya Pradesh, affiliated with Devi Ahilya Vishwavidyalaya and approved by the Bar Council of India. For admissions, IIL allocates 20% of its seats in major law programs to candidates based on their CLAT scores, while the majority are filled through its entrance exam (IILET) and a small portion through 12th-grade marks. Applicants seeking admission via CLAT must register, appear for the exam, and submit their CLAT scorecard during the IIL application process. 3. GITAM School of Law, Visakhapatnam

GITAM School of Law, Visakhapatnam, established in 2012, is a private institution affiliated with GITAM University and approved by the Bar Council of India. The school offers undergraduate and postgraduate law programs, including BA LLB (Hons.), BBA LLB (Hons.), and LLM. Admission to these courses can be secured through CLAT, LSAT, or the university’s own GAT exam. The following table mentions the law courses offered by the school through CLAT.

8. Institute of Law, Nirma University, Ahmedabad

Institute of Law, Nirma University (ILNU), Ahmedabad, established in 2007, provides undergraduate and postgraduate law programs, including BA LLB (Hons.), BCom LLB (Hons.), and LLM. Admission to these law courses is based on the candidate’s All India merit rank in CLAT, with no provision for direct admission. Shortlisted candidates are invited for on-campus counseling and seat allotment based on their CLAT performance. The following table mentions the details of the courses offered through CLAT scores.

10. Shanmugha Arts Science Technology Research and Academy, Thanjavur

Shanmugha Arts, Science, Technology & Research Academy (SASTRA), Thanjavur, established in 1984, is a NAAC A++ accredited deemed university known for its academic excellence and strong industry collaborations. The School of Law at SASTRA offers integrated undergraduate law programs such as BA LLB (Hons.) and BCom LLB, with admissions based on a combination of CLAT scores (25% weightage) and Class 12 marks (75% weightage). Candidates must apply online, submit their CLAT scorecard, and participate in the counseling process for final seat allotment. Colleges Accepting CLAT Scores Other Than NLU FAQs

Which colleges accept CLAT scores apart from NLUs?

Many private and government law colleges, such as Jindal Global Law School, UPES School of Law, ICFAI Law School, Alliance University, and Amity Law School, accept CLAT scores for admissions.

Are CLAT scores valid for both undergraduate and postgraduate law programs in these colleges?

Yes, several affiliated and private colleges use CLAT scores for admission to both UG (like BA LLB, BBA LLB) and PG (LLM) law programs.

Do these colleges conduct their own entrance exams in addition to accepting CLAT?

Some colleges may have their own entrance tests or conduct personal interviews, but many offer direct admission based on CLAT merit. 

What is the fee structure in private law colleges accepting CLAT scores?

The fees vary widely based on the location and other parameters of the colleges. Private colleges like Jindal Global Law School may charge Rs 9 to 10 lakhs per year, while others like Alliance University and UPES charge around Rs 2 to 3 lakhs per year.

Can I apply to both NLUs and private colleges with my CLAT score?

Yes, you can apply to NLUs through the centralized CLAT counseling and separately to private colleges that accept CLAT scores.
